Subject: [PATCHv2 01/29] x86/tdx: Detect running as a TDX guest in early boot

cc_platform_has() API is used in the kernel to enable confidential
computing features. Since TDX guest is a confidential computing
platform, it also needs to use this API.

In preparation of extending cc_platform_has() API to support TDX guest,
use CPUID instruction to detect support for TDX guests in the early
boot code (via tdx_early_init()). Since copy_bootdata() is the first
user of cc_platform_has() API, detect the TDX guest status before it.

Since cc_plaform_has() API will be used frequently across the boot
code, instead of repeatedly detecting the TDX guest status using the
CPUID instruction, detect once and cache the result. Add a function
(is_tdx_guest()) to read the cached TDX guest status in CC APIs.

Define a synthetic feature flag (X86_FEATURE_TDX_GUEST) and set this
bit in a valid TDX guest platform. This feature bit will be used to
do TDX-specific handling in some areas of the ARCH code where a
function call to check for TDX guest status is not cost-effective
(for example, TDX hypercall support).

+config INTEL_TDX_GUEST
+	bool "Intel TDX (Trust Domain Extensions) - Guest Support"
+	depends on X86_64 && CPU_SUP_INTEL
+	depends on X86_X2APIC
+	help
+	  Support running as a guest under Intel TDX.  Without this support,
+	  the guest kernel can not boot or run under TDX.
+	  TDX includes memory encryption and integrity capabilities
+	  which protect the confidentiality and integrity of guest
+	  memory contents and CPU state. TDX guests are protected from
+	  potential attacks from the VMM.

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/tdx.c b/arch/x86/kernel/tdx.c
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..1ef6979a6434
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/tdx.c
@@ -0,0 +1,31 @@
+//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
+/* Copyright (C) 2021-2022 Intel Corporation */
+
+#undef pr_fmt
+#define pr_fmt(fmt)     "tdx: " fmt
+
+#include <linux/cpufeature.h>
+#include <asm/tdx.h>
+
+static bool tdx_guest_detected __ro_after_init;
+
+bool is_tdx_guest(void)
+{
+	return tdx_guest_detected;
+}
+
+void __init tdx_early_init(void)
+{
+	u32 eax, sig[3];
+
+	cpuid_count(TDX_CPUID_LEAF_ID, 0, &eax, &sig[0], &sig[2],  &sig[1]);
+
+	if (memcmp(TDX_IDENT, sig, 12))
+		return;
+
+	tdx_guest_detected = true;
+
+	setup_force_cpu_cap(X86_FEATURE_TDX_GUEST);
+
+	pr_info("Guest detected\n");
+}
